Transaction b30574225dff79d687b25f3e78d478df9a5243286d35eccaec122a153bfb2252

1 Input
1 Outputs
  • b30574225dff79d687b25f3e78d478df9a5243286d35eccaec122a153bfb2252:0
  • value  40308
    address  37LyWBhqvnDULaefkcxWc9ACefhyV5y1f6